How much do executive film producer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average yearly pay for executive film producer in the United States is $100,707.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$69,500.00 and $110,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an executive film producer do?

An Executive Film Producer is responsible for overseeing the financial and managerial aspects of film production. They secure funding, manage budgets, hire key personnel, and make high-level creative and business decisions. Unlike producers who may be involved in daily operations, executive producers typically focus on the overall vision and financial viability of the project. Their involvement can range from developing the initial concept to overseeing distribution and marketing strategies.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an executive film producer?

To thrive as an Executive Film Producer, you need extensive industry knowledge, strong leadership abilities, financial acumen, and usually a background in film production or business. Familiarity with budgeting software, production management tools, and knowledge of legal contracts are crucial, along with experience in securing financing and distribution deals. Outstanding negotiation, communication, and problem-solving skills set top producers apart in managing diverse teams and complex projects. These competencies ensure the successful delivery, funding, and distribution of films in a highly competitive and dynamic industry.

What are some common challenges executive film producers face when managing multiple film projects simultaneously?

Executive Film Producers often juggle several projects at different stages of development, which can lead to challenges in resource allocation, budgeting, and maintaining clear communication across teams. Balancing creative vision with financial constraints and timelines requires strong organizational skills and the ability to make swift, informed decisions. Effective delegation and building trust with directors, production managers, and other stakeholders are key to ensuring each project stays on track and meets its objectives.

What is the difference between Executive Film Producer vs Film Producer?

AspectExecutive Film ProducerFilm Producer
ResponsibilitiesOversees overall project strategy, secures funding, manages high-level decisionsHandles day-to-day production tasks, manages crew, coordinates schedules
CredentialsExperience in film production, strong industry connections, often a background in business or managementExperience in film production, knowledge of filmmaking processes, often with a background in directing or producing
Work EnvironmentHigh-level meetings, negotiations, and strategic planningOn set, in editing rooms, and production offices

The main difference is that the Executive Film Producer focuses on overall project oversight, funding, and strategic decisions, while the Film Producer manages the daily production operations. Both roles require extensive industry experience, but their scope and focus differ significantly.
